1.Molecular biological research and molecular homologous modeling of Bw.03 subgroup
Li WANG ; Yongkui KONG ; Huifang JIN ; Xin LIU ; Ying XIE ; Xue LIU ; Yanli CHANG ; Yafang WANG ; Shumiao YANG ; Di ZHU ; Qiankun YANG
Chinese Journal of Blood Transfusion 2025;38(1):112-115
[Objective] To study the molecular biological mechanism for a case of ABO blood group B subtype, and perform three-dimensional modeling of the mutant enzyme. [Methods] The ABO phenotype was identified by the tube method and microcolumn gel method; the ABO gene of the proband was detected by sequence-specific primer polymerase chain reaction (PCR-SSP), and the exon 6 and 7 of the ABO gene were sequenced and analyzed. Homologous modeling of Bw.03 glycosyltransferase (GT) was carried out by Modeller and analyzed by PyMOL2.5.0 software. [Results] The weakening B antigen was detected in the proband sample by forward typing, and anti-B antibody was detected by reverse typing. PCR-SSP detection showed B, O gene, and the sequencing results showed c.721 C>T mutation in exon 7 of the B gene, resulting in p. Arg 241 Trp. Compared with the wild type, the structure of Bw.03GT was partially changed, and the intermolecular force analysis showed that the original three hydrogen bonds at 241 position disappeared. [Conclusion] Blood group molecular biology examination is helpful for the accurate identification of ambiguous blood group. Homologous modeling more intuitively shows the key site for the weakening of Bw.03 GT activity. The intermolecular force analysis can explain the root cause of enzyme activity weakening.
2.Impact of Wenyang lishui formula on ventricular remodeling in rats with pulmonary hypertension-induced right heart failure
Sijian FENG ; Yan HUANG ; Aimin XING ; Mei YUAN ; Yafang LIU ; Weiming WANG
China Pharmacy 2025;36(20):2531-2536
OBJECTIVE To discuss the impact of Wenyang lishui formula on ventricular remodeling in rats with pulmonary hypertension-induced right heart failure (RHF) based on the Hippo/Yes-associated protein (YAP) signaling pathway. METHODS Ten rats were randomly selected as the control group. The remaining 63 rats were given a single intraperitoneal injection of monocrotaline to establish the pulmonary hypertension-induced RHF model. The 50 rats that successfully underwent the model establishment were randomly divided into the RHF group, low-dose group of Wenyang lishui formula (4.25 g/kg), high-dose group of the Wenyang lishui formula (17.00 g/kg), furosemide group (20 mg/kg), and high-dose group of Wenyang lishui formula+ Hippo/YAP signaling pathway activator group (17.00 g/kg of Δ Wenyang lishui formula+16 mg/kg of PY-60), with 10 rats in each group. The rats in each group were given the corresponding drug solution or normal saline by gavage or/andtail vein injection, once a day, for 4 consecutive weeks. During the experiment, the general conditions of the rats in each group were observed; after the last administration, the right ventricular diameter, right atrial diameter, end-diastolic volume, pulmonary artery blood flow acceleration time (PAAT) and its ratio to ejection time (ET) (PAAT/ET), pulmonary artery pressure and its ratio to pulmonary arterial flow velocity (pulmonary artery pressure/velocity) were measured. The plasma levels of brain natriuretic peptide and angiotensin Ⅱ (Ang Ⅱ) were detected. The pathological changes of the right ventricular tissue were observed, and the collagen volume fraction, the phosphorylation levels of the large tumor suppressor 1/2 (LATS1/2) and YAP, and the protein expression of the transcriptional coactivator of PDZ-binding motif (TAZ) were also detected. RESULTS Compared with the RHF group, the rats in Wenyang lishui formula low-dose and high-dose groups showed improved hair color, movement, diet, and mental state. The atrophy of right ventricular myocardial cells, the increase of inflammatory cells, collagen deposition, and hypertrophy of myocardial fibers were significantly alleviated. The right ventricular internal diameter, right atrial internal diameter, end-diastolic volume, pulmonary artery pressure, pulmonary artery pressure/velocity, the plasma levels of brain natriuretic peptide and AngⅡ , collagen volume fraction, the phosphorylation level of YAP and protein expression of TAZ were significantly decreased, while the PAAT, PAAT/ET and the phosphorylation level of LATS1/2 were significantly increased (P<0.05). PY-60 could significantly reverse the improvement effects of high-dose Wenyang lishui formula on the above quantitative indicators (P< 0.05). CONCLUSIONS Wenyang lishui formula can restore the right heart function of pulmonary hypertension-induced RHF rats, reduce their pulmonary artery pressure, alleviate the pathological changes in their cardiac tissues, and the above effects may be related to the activation of Hippo expression and the inhibition of YAP phosphorylation.
3.Diarrhea caused by foodborne Salmonella infection in children aged 0-6 years in Guizhou Province from 2016 to 2023
LIAO Hongxia, WANG Yafang, LIU Lin, ZHANG Lili, YANG Qi, LI Lei
Chinese Journal of School Health 2025;46(5):732-736
Objective:
To analyze the epidemilogical and seasonal characteristics of foodborne Salmonella-associated diarrhea among children aged 0-6 years in Guizhou Province from 2016 to 2023, so as to provide a basis for the prevention and control of foodborne diseases.
Methods:
Data were extracted from the Foodborne Disease Survellance System for cases reported between January 1, 2016, and December 31, 2023. The incidence, seasonal characteristics, and peak periods were analyzed by the method of concentration and circular distribution.
Results:
A total of 6 434 cases of diarrhea in children aged 0-6 years were collected, and 455 cases of Salmonella were detected, with a positive detection rate of 7.07%. Salmonella typhimurium was the main serotype causing diarrhea (59.34%). The peak of the disease was from May 3 to September 30, with certain seasonal characteristics. The highest detection rate was found in children aged 1-3 years (8.66%). Among food types, the positive detection rates of Salmonella were relatively high in other foods (17.39%), fruits and their products (10.22%), infant and toddler foods (10.09%), and aquatic animals and their products (9.80%). The processing and packaging methods of food were mainly home-made (9.38%) and bulk food (7.54%).
Conclusions
The detection rate of Salmonella in children aged 0-6 years is high in Guizhou Province, with strong seasonal characteristics. The detection rates of other foods, fruits and their products, infant and toddler foods, and aquatic animals and their products are high. Enhanced pathogen surveillance for susceptible populations and high-risk foods, coupled with public health education during summer/autumn, is recommended.
4.Design and application of an adjustable facial support pad for prone position ventilation.
Zhimin ZHANG ; Xiaojie CHEN ; Xinyu YAO ; Bin LI ; Yafang WANG ; Lin ZHANG
Chinese Critical Care Medicine 2025;37(1):70-72
In recent years, prone mechanical ventilation has been widely used to improve oxygenation dysfunction in critically ill patients. During prone mechanical ventilation, the patient's face is compressed for a long time, and due to the difficulty in changing, facial pressure injuries and ocular complications are common and severe. These complications increase patient discomfort, reduce their tolerance and compliance with prone ventilation, and even cause tracheal tube displacement or dislodgement, leading to significant clinical challenges. In order to change this situation, the medical staff of the department of critical care medicine of the Second People's Hospital of Hengshui and the department of critical care medicine of Harrison International Peace Hospital had developed an adjustable facial support pad for prone ventilation, and obtained a National Utility Model Patent of China (ZL 2022 2 3295294.4). The device is composed of a facial support platform, a supporting telescopic foot frame and so on. There are front, back, left and right adjustable tracks below the support cushion platform, which can be adjusted to the best state suitable for the patient's face shape, which can alleviate the facial pressure injuries and ocular complications caused by the different sizes of each patient's face, improve the patient's comfort, and reduce the incidence of facial pressure injury and the occurrence of ocular complications of the patient. The height of the platform is adjusted by the telescopic feet, and there is a hook assembly below, which can be fixed by the clamp of the ventilator tubing, so as to prevent the ventilator tubing from pulling the endotracheal intubation due to the gravity of condensation, resulting in the displacement or even prolapse of the tracheal intubation, and reducing the occurrence of adverse events of tracheal intubation. It is worth promoting in the clinic.

5.Evaluation of perioperative nutritional status and body composition in patients with stomach neoplasms
Hong WANG ; Zhijie DING ; Yafang YE ; Lihui LIN ; Dandan KANG ; Yanping YUAN ; Lei LI
Chinese Journal of Practical Nursing 2024;40(10):772-779
Objective:To investigate the nutritional risk, incidence of malnutrition, and intake of three major energy-supplying nutrients, analyze changes in their body composition and the possible influencing factors in patients with stomach neoplasms during perioperative period in order to provide a theoretical basis for the nutritional management of patients with stomach neoplasms during perioperative period.Methods:This was a cross-sectional study. A total of 105 patients who underwent gastric cancer radical surgery in the Gastrointestinal Department of Zhongshan Hospital Affiliated to Xiamen University from June 2021 to May 2023 were taken as the research subjects using fixed-point continuous sampling method. They were recruited for screening and assessment using Nutritional Risk Screening 2002 (NRS 2002) and Patient-Generated Subjective Global Assessment (PG-SGA). Nutrients intake during the perioperative period were investigated using the 24-h recall method and dietary diary method, etc. Body compositions were measured using the bioelectrical resistance method.Results:Among the 105 patients, there were 78 males and 27 females, with an average age of (61.5 ± 10.3) years. About 83.8% (88/105) gastric cancer patients were at nutritional risk and 82.9% (87/105) were malnourished. The preoperative and postoperative energy intake were (1 646.1 ± 321.5) and (1 317.2 ± 365.8) kcal (1 kcal=4.184 kJ), respectively, which were significantly lower than the target amount of (1 896.7 ± 262.9) kcal, the difference was statistically significant ( t=6.23, 8.29, both P<0.05).The preoperative body mass, muscle mass, skeletal muscle, fat mass, and skeletal muscle index were (51.5 ± 9.6), (40.8 ± 6.0), (23.6 ± 4.0), (8.3 ± 4.9) kg, and 6.7 ± 0.8 respectively, while the postoperative values were (50.0 ± 9.1), (39.8 ± 6.0), (22.8 ± 3.6), (7.8 ± 5.2) kg, and 6.5 ± 0.8 respectively, with statistically significant differences between the two groups ( t values were 2.89-10.61, all P<0.05). Logistic multivariate regression analysis showed that the operation time ( OR=3.984, 95% CI 1.433-11.080, P<0.05) and energy satisfaction ( OR=0.053, 95% CI 0.005-0.610, P<0.05) were independent influencing factors for the degree of skeletal muscle loss. Conclusions:During perioperative period, the gastric cancer patients had poor nutritional status with insufficient nutrient intake and accelerated loss of body muscle and fat. Therefore, it was necessary to conduct a comprehensive nutritional evaluation for patients with stomach neoplasms during perioperative period in time and take steps to promote recovery by providing individualized nutritional therapy.
6.The Influence of Late Pregnancy Perineal Massage Combined with Hip Training on Labor Outcomes and Psychological Elasticity of Primiparous Pregnant Women
Wenjuan WANG ; Zhuoxuan LAI ; Lin-Gling ZHANG ; Yafang DENG ; Zonglian GUO ; Wenzhi CAI
The Journal of Practical Medicine 2024;40(7):1017-1022
Objective To investigate the effects of perineal massage combined with hip joint exercise on the outcome of delivery and mental resilience of primipara.Methods 90 pregnant women in the third trimester(after 36 weeks)who obtained the knowledge about perineal massage from midwife clinic were randomly divided into two groups with 45 cases each.The control group received regular antenatal examination and family self-exercise;the experimental group received perineal massage and hip joint training combined treatment.The delivery outcome,birth experience and maternal mental resilience of the two groups were compared.Results the number of vaginal delivery in the experimental group were higher than that in the control group(P<0.05);the second stage of labor was significantly shorter than that of the control group(P<0.05);the perineal integrity rate was higher than that of the control group(P<0.05);the scores of all dimensions in delivery experience questionnaire were higher than that of the control group(P<0.05);the scores of all dimensions in maternal mental resilience were higher than those of the control group(P<0.05)after intervention.Conclusion The perineal massage which conducted by midwives combined with hip movement can effectively improve the quality of delivery,relieve the negative emotions of pregnant women,improve the psychological elasticity level of pregnant women,and improve the delivery outcomes.
7.Research progress on the regulation of endometriosis by PI3K/Akt signaling pathway and the intervention effect of traditional Chinese medicine
Quanyang LI ; Yafang HAO ; Guotai WU ; Ruiqiong WANG
Chinese Journal of Clinical Pharmacology and Therapeutics 2024;29(5):501-511
Endometriosis(Endometriosis,EMs)is a disease caused by abnormal colonization of the endometrial stroma or glands to sites other than the coated mucosa of the uterine cavity.Phospho-lipid inositol 3 kinase(phosphoinositide 3-kinase,PI3K)/protein kinase B(protein kinase B,Akt)sig-naling pathway is involved in the process of focal blood vessel formation,cell autophagic apoptosis,migration and invasion,and is one of the classic pathways regulating the pathological characteris-tics of EMs.The characteristics of multi-compo-nent,multi-target and multi-pathway of TCM have significant advantages in the treatment of EMs.Some TCM active components and TCM com-pounds can interfere with the PI3K/Akt signaling pathway,thus inhibiting the treatment of endome-triotic tissues,reducing pain and alleviating fibrotic lesions.By explaining the connection between the key targets of PI3K/Akt signaling pathway and EMs,this paper summarizes and summarizes the re-search status of EMs by regulating PI3K/Akt signal pathway in home and abroad,aiming to provide a new perspective and idea for the use of traditional Chinese medicine and compound to treat EMs.
8.Efficacy of monosialotetrahexosyl ganglioside combined with recombinant human erythropoietin in the treatment of neonates with hypoxic-ischemic encephalopathy
Jing ZHANG ; Yafang REN ; Yan WANG ; Pin WANG ; Yue WANG
Journal of Xinxiang Medical College 2024;41(9):857-861
Objective To investigate the clinical effect of monosialotetrahexosyl ganglioside(GM1)combined with recombinant human erythropoietin(rhEPO)in treating neonates with hypoxic-ischemic encephalopathy(HIE)and its influence on inflammatory factors and neurological function.Methods A total of 78 neonates with HIE admitted to the Department of Neonatology of Nanyang Central Hospital from June 2017 to June 2020 were selected as the research subjects,and they were divided into the control group(n=39)and the observation group(n=39)by random number table method.All neonates were given routine treatment,including oxygen inhalation,maintenance of water,electrolyte and acid-base balance,control of convulsions and intracranial pressure,and moderate and severe HIE neonates were given mild hypothermia therapy on this basis.Neonates in the control group were given rhEPO 200 IU·kg-1 via subcutaneous injection on the basis of routine treatment,3 times a week.Neonates in the observation group were given GM1 20 mg intravenously once a day on the basis of the treatment of the control group.Seven days were taken as one course of treatment,and four courses of continuous treatment were taken.Moderate and severe HIE neonates were treated for 1-3 courses additionally according to their condition.The total effective rate of the two groups after treatment was compared.The neurological function of neonates in the two groups was evaluated by neonatal behavioral neurological assessment(NBNA)before,14 and 28 days after the treatment.The interleukin-6(IL-6),intercellular adhesion molecule-1(ICAM-1),tumor necrosis factor-α(TNF-α),hypoxia inducible factor-1α(HIF-1α)and neuron specific enolase(NSE)in the serum were measured by enzyme-linked immunosorbent assay before,14 and 28 days after the treatment.Results The total effective rate of treatment in the control group and the observation group was 69.23%(27/39)and 94.87%(37/39),respectively;the total effective rate of the observation group was significantly higher than that in the control group(x2=8.705,P=0.003).The total effective rate of treatment for mild HIE neonates in both groups was 100%.The total effective rate of moderate and severe HIE neonates in the observation group was significantly higher than that in the control group(x2=4.843,3.898,P=0.028,0.048).There was no significant difference in NBNA scores between the two groups before treatment(P>0.05).The NBNA scores of neonates in the two groups were significantly higher on the 14 and 28 days after treatment(P<0.05).The NBNA scores of the two groups were significantly higher on the 28 day after treatment than those on the 14 day after treatment(P<0.05).The NBNA scores of the neonates in the observation group were significantly higher than those in the control group on the 14 and 28 days after treatment(P<0.05).There was no significant difference in serum ICAM-1,IL-6,TNF-α,HIF-1α and NSE levels between the two groups before treatment(P>0.05).The serum ICAM-1,IL-6,TNF-α,HIF-1α and NSE levels in the two groups on the 14 and 28 days after treatment were significantly lower than those before treatment(P<0.05);the levels of serum ICAM-1,IL-6,TNF-α,HIF-1α and NSE in the two groups were significantly lower on the 28 day after treatment than those on the 14 day after treatment(P<0.05).On the 14 and 28 days after treatment,the serum ICAM-1,IL-6,TNF-α,HIF-1α and NSE levels of the neonates in the observation group were significantly lower than those of the control group(P<0.05).Conclusion GM 1 combined with rhEPO in the treatment of neonatal HIE can reduce the levels of inflammatory factors,serum HIF-1α and NSE,and promote the recovery of neurological function,with significant effects.
9.Clinical Efficacy of Low-dose Dopamine Combined with Tolvaptan in the Treatment of Type Ⅰ Cardiorenal Syndrome
Lingchao YANG ; Jian WANG ; Yafang ZHA
Journal of Medical Research 2024;53(6):94-98
Objective To observe the clinical efficacy of low-dose dobutamine combined with tolvaptan in the treatment of type Ⅰcardiorenal syndrome.Methods A total of 104 patients with type 1 cardiorenal syndrome admitted to the Department of Cardiology,Xinhua Hospital Affiliated to Shanghai Jiao Tong University of Medicine were selected as study subjects.The patients were randomly divid-ed into control group and experimental group,52 patients in each group.The control group which accepted oral tolvaptan 15mg,and the experimental group which accepted the treatment of low-dose of dopamine[2μg/(kg·min)]with intravenous infusion,and they were treatment for 7d.The primary endpoint was the cardiorenal serological index after 7days of treatment.Results After treatment,the total effective rates of experimental group and control group were 86.53%(45/52)and 67.30%(35/52),respectively,and the difference was statistically significant(P<0.05).After treatment,the serological levels of cardiorenal functions and 12h urine volume were more significantly improved in two groups,and the improvement effect of experimental group was better than that of control group,the difference was statistically significant(P<0.05).The levels of serum inflammatory cytokines after treatment were significantly lower than before treatment,and the difference was statistically significant(P<0.05).Conclusion Low-dose dopamine combined with tolvaptan in treating type 1 cardio-renal syndrome can significantly improve patients'cardiac and renal function.
10.Nutritional status of 15 children with progeria
Yafang DU ; Qi LONG ; Jingjing WANG ; Ming MA ; Jianhua MAO
Chinese Journal of Pediatrics 2024;62(2):170-174
Objective:To analyze the nutritional status of progeria, and to provide reference for scientific nutritional management of progeria.Methods:This cross-sectional study included 15 children with progeria who were treated at Children′s Hospital, Zhejiang University School of Medicine, between April 2022 and May 2023. Data of medical history, physical examination, laboratory tests, dietary survey and body composition were collected and analyzed.Results:Among 15 patients there were 7 males and 8 females, aged 7.8 (2.3, 10.8) years. Twelve of the 15 patients exhibited signs of malnutrition. A 24-hour dietary survey was carried out in 14 of them. The daily energy intake of 11 cases was below recommended levels. Carbohydrate intake was insufficient in 10 cases, protein intake was insufficient in 7 cases, and fat intake was insufficient in 12 cases. Deficiencies in calcium, magnesium, iron and zinc were noted in 13, 13, 9 and 10 cases, respectively. Body composition was determined by dual-energy X-ray absorptiometry in 8 cases, and the bone mineral density was below average in 5 of them.Conclusions:Malnutrition, characterized by reduced energy intake, micronutrient deficiencies, and alteration in body composition, is prevalent in children with progeria. Regular routine nutritional assessment and proper interventions may benefit their long-term health status.
